Job Title: Health, Safety & Environmental Coordinator | Location Belfast
So whats it all about?
As our next Health, Safety & Environmental Coordinator, you'll be a driven individual looking to achieve results. Youll be a strong communicator who enjoys interacting with a variety of colleagues and stakeholders with an approachable nature.
To be successful in this role, youll thrive on working within a team with a team player attitude.
Working with a team of dedicated professionals, you'll be instrumental in driving health and safety administration. Your role is to support the HSE manager in promoting and coordinating health and safety activities. Your remit will be to ensure compliance with all health and safety regulations and procedures.
As a part of your remit, youll be undertaking risk assessments, implementing safe systems of work, and health and safety administration, ensuring compliance.
As our next Health, Safety & Environmental Coordinator, youll be passionate about promoting a positive health and safety culture, working towards ensuring the safety and well-being of all employees.
You will take pride in creating a safe and supportive work environment, and promoting health and safety best practices.
The Key Requirements…
- Experience within a health and safety role
- NEBOSH General Certificate
- Experience within a manufacturing environment

How to prepare for a job interview at Hovis Ltd
✨Know Your Health and Safety Regulations
Familiarise yourself with the key health and safety regulations relevant to the role. Be prepared to discuss how you have applied these in previous positions, especially in a manufacturing environment.
✨Showcase Your Communication Skills
As a Health and Safety Coordinator, strong communication is vital. Prepare examples of how you've effectively communicated safety protocols to colleagues and stakeholders, highlighting your approachable nature.
✨Demonstrate Team Player Attitude
Emphasise your ability to work collaboratively within a team. Share experiences where you contributed to a positive health and safety culture and supported your team in achieving safety goals.
✨Prepare for Scenario-Based Questions
Expect scenario-based questions related to risk assessments and implementing safe systems of work. Think through how you would handle specific situations and be ready to explain your thought process.
